Why are handles of kitchen utensils made of bakelite? Give reasons

Handles of kitchen utensils are made of bakelite because bakelite is bad conductor of heat, which doesn't let the heat pass through it.So while cooking whenever we will hold the hot utensil, it will not burn our hand.

Bakelite is a bad conductor of heat and has a very high melting point. This is the reason why it used to make the handles on cooking utensils. The cooking utensils themselves are made of steel which is a good conductor of heat. While cooking, you possibly cant hold the utensil or the pot with bare hands. Here bakelite handles come into handy because they remain cool even when the pot is hot and eases the hassle of handling the pot.
